How they compare
Cyprus currently reports 1,874 1000 USD against 1,746 1000 USD in Paraguay, a difference of 128 1000 USD.
That makes Cyprus's figure about 1.1 times Paraguay's.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Cyprus ahead.
Cyprus ranks 110th and Paraguay ranks 111th of 213 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Cyprus averaged higher in 2 and Paraguay in 1.

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products. More detailed information on wood products, including definitions, can be found at: https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en
